A Florida Room addition in Loveland, CO, typically involves creating a glass-enclosed space that extends the living area of a home. This project can enhance indoor-outdoor living and provide a bright, comfortable environment. Understanding key factors can help in planning and comparing options for Florida Room installations.
- Materials: Commonly includes aluminum or vinyl framing with glass panels or screens, selected based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from small sunroom extensions to larger, multi-season spaces, depending on available space and homeowner needs.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ves framing, glazing, and sealing, with complexity varying based on existing structure integration and design features.
- Permitting: Typically requires local building permits, especially for larger structures or if electrical or HVAC systems are included.
- Extras: Options may include ceiling fans, electrical outlets, flooring upgrades, or climate control systems to enhance functionality.
